About AmeriTech College
Founded in 1979, AmeriTech College provides nursing and healthcare training programs from campus locations in Provo and Draper, Utah. AmeriTech has a unique educational model that delivers a hand's on approach to learning with an emphasis in bringing the "real world" of medical professions into the classroom in order to provide the best possible training for their students.
Each program features hands-on training combined with streamlined, quality instruction. Registered Nursing Program
AmeriTech College offers an RN program that prepares students for an Associate of Applied Science in Nursing which enables graduates to apply for the NCLEX exam for registered nursing.
Students spend a portion of their time in clinical training in local hospitals and other facilities. This training gives real-life experience gained from working with health care professionals and is an invaluable aid for our students. AmeriTech College also utilizes various Human Patient Simulators. This simulator experience will give our students experience in true-to-life scenarios and immediate patient feedback simulating a patient's response to various treatments.

Accreditation
AmeriTech College is institutionally accredited by the Accrediting Bureau of Health Education Schools (ABHES) a national accrediting body recognized by the Secretary of the United States Department of Education. The Nursing Program is also accredited by the National League for Nursing Accrediting Commission (NLNAC) and approved by the Utah State Board of Nursing for operation within the State of Utah.
